Heredia
Just 11km northeast of San José lies the lively city of HEREDIA, boosted by the student population of the Universidad Nacional (UNA), at the eastern end of town, and famed for its soccer team, one of the best and most popular in the country. This "City of the Flowers" is also the booming Central American headquarters for several global high-tech firms. The town centre is a little rundown, with the Parque Central flanked by tall palms and a few historical buildings. Small and easy to navigate, Heredia is a natural jumping-off point for excursions to the nearby historical hamlet of Barva and to the town of San José de la Montaña, a gateway to Volcán Barva. Many tourists also come for the Café Britt Finca tour, hosted by the nation's largest coffee exporter, about 3km north of the town centre.
